Shares of Fidelity National Information Services, Inc. ( FIS ) have been a very poor performer over the past year, losing 30% of their value. Ongoing concerns about long-term growth in the payments sector, amid competition from fintech players, have weighed on sentiment. FIS has also faced pressure from past M&A deals, and potential regulatory hurdles around a planned asset swap have also negatively impacted shares. That said, investors received some good news on Wednesday when the company reported stronger-than-expected results. I last covered shares in August , when I rated the stock a “ H old,” given slow growth but a fair valuation. In hindsight, I should have rated FIS a "S ell" given its 12% drop.
